Efficient communication system using time division multiplexing and timing adjustment control
First Claim
1. A system for communication comprising a base station, a plurality of user stations, and a transmission format;
- said transmission format comprising a plurality of time frames of equal duration, each of said time frames comprising a base transmission portion, a collective guard portion, and a user transmission portion, said collective guard portion located between said base transmission portion and said user transmission portion, each base transmission portion comprised of a plurality of base time slots and each user transmission portion comprised of a plurality of user time slots;
said base station comprising the capability to transmit a plurality of sub-messages in each of said base time slots of said base transmission portion of a time frame, each said sub-message transmitted in a base time slot transmitted to a different user station, and in which one or more sub-messages from a plurality of base time slots of a time frame comprises a base-to-user message for a user station; and
a user station of said plurality of user stations comprising the capability to transmit a user-to-base message in a user time slot of said user transmission portion of a time frame.

Abstract
A system for time division multiplexed communication over a single frequency band in which guard time overhead is reduced by active adjustment of reverse link transmission timing as a function of round trip propagation time. In one embodiment, during a first portion of a time frame, a base station issues a single burst segmented into time slots comprising data directed to each user station. After a single collective guard time, the user stations respond, one by one, in allocated time slots on the same frequency as the base station, with only minimal guard times between each reception. In order to prevent interference among the user transmissions, the base station measures the round trip propagation time for each user station and commands the user stations to advance or retard their transmission timing as necessary. To establish the initial range of a new user station, a short message is sent by the new user station during the collective guard portion (or, alternatively, during an available time slot), from which the base station calculates the propagation delay and hence the distance of the user station. Messages sent from the base station to the user stations may be interleaved so as to reduce the effects of potential noise or interference.
